这里是文章模块栏目内容页
sqlite数据库底层原理的简单介绍

本文目录一览:

sqlite适合实时数据吗

该数据库适合实时数据。SQLite是嵌入式数据库:SQLite可嵌入到使用应用程序中,共用相同的进程空间,而不是单独的一个进程,所以SQLite在程序内部是完整的,自包含的数据库引擎。

SQLite:轻量级的嵌入式数据库,不需要独立的服务器,适合小型应用和移动设备应用。Microsoft SQL Server:商业数据库,适合在Windows环境下使用,具有强大的功能和高性能。

在Qt中,可以使用QtOrm或QxOrm等ORM框架进行实时数据存储。将实时数据保存到本地文件中,再使用数据库工具(如MySQL Workbench、Navicat等)将文件导入到数据库中。这种方法适用于数据量较小的情况。

总之,SQLite是一种简单、高效、易于集成的本地数据库,适用于在手机等移动设备上存储和管理数据。SQLite添加、更新和删除数据是常见的数据库操作。然而,数据越高并不一定好,这取决于具体的需求和情况。

eagle底层内嵌了sqlite吗?

答案:是的,Eagle 底层内嵌了 SQLite。解释:Eagle 是一个用于电子设计自动化(EDA)的软件,它可以用于设计电路板和原理图。Eagle 底层内嵌了 SQLite 数据库,这使得它能够高效地存储和管理设计数据。

只有hive才能数据分层吗,sqlite能不能分层呢?

1、“面向主题的”数据运营层,也叫ODS层,是最接近数据源中数据的一层,数据源中的数据,经过抽取、洗净、传输,也就说传说中的 ETL 之后,装入本层。本层的数据,总体上大多是按照源头业务系统的分类方式而分类的。

2、软件系统的分层结构:第一层:基础架构基础架构指云平台、操作系统、网络、存储、数据库和编译器等。随着目前云计算越来越普及,很多的中小型公司都选择了大公司的云计算平台,而不是自己研发和维护基础架构。

3、Application Data Service(应用数据服务)。该层主要是提供数据产品和数据分析使用 的数据,一般会存放在ES、MySQL等系统中供线上系统使用,也可能会存在Hive或者Druid中供数据分析和数据挖掘使用。

4、分层方法: (1)专题分层:每个图层对应一个专题,包含某一种或某一类数据。如地貌层、水系层、道路层、 居民层等。 (2) 时间序列分层: 即把即把不同时间或不同时期的数据作为一个数据层。

5、Hive用于数据校验 Mysql可以用于指标计算结果的存储 数据分层 数据源:目前数据源主要是Binlog,通过Canal监控各个业务系统的Mysql,将binlog发送至kafka。

sqlite是关系型数据库吗

SQLite是一种轻型数据库,常用于移动设备和嵌入式系统中。在手机存储中,SQLite被用作一个本地的嵌入式数据库,用于存储和管理应用程序的数据。

而SQLite是一个轻量级的关系型数据库管理系统,适用于嵌入式系统和平板电脑等设备。Microsoft Access则是一种基于Office套件的关系型数据库管理系统。

大型的有:oracle、sqlserver、dbinfomix、Sybase等。开源的有:MySQL、Postpresql等。文件型的有:Access、SQLAnywhere、sqlite、interbase等。

常用数据库有mysql、oracle、sqlserver、sqlite等。